Sarajevo International Airport starts selling Tickets to Paris

Published: February 6, 2025
Share
SHARE

Sarajevo International Airport has officially started selling airline tickets to a new destination – Paris. Passengers will be able to fly to Paris Beauvais Airport from March 31, 2025, adding the French capital to the list of European metropolises connected to Sarajevo.

Tickets are already available at the airport’s ticket offices, as well as online via the Ryanair website. Flights to Paris will operate twice a week, on Mondays and Thursdays.

“Welcome to the city of light and romance! Visit the famous Eiffel Tower, explore the artistic treasures of the Louvre and stroll the charming streets of Montmartre. Paris awaits you!”, says Sarajevo International Airport.

This year, Sarajevo Airport will have flights to 39 destinations, including European cities such as Rome, London, Berlin, Frankfurt, Cologne, Stuttgart, Oslo, Stockholm, Copenhagen, Zurich, Memmingen, Charleroi, Bergamo, Düsseldorf, Girona, Karlsruhe, Thessaloniki, Athens, Warsaw and Vienna. The list of destinations also includes regional and distant cities such as Zagreb, Belgrade, Istanbul, Antalya, Izmir and Bodrum, as well as destinations in the Middle East, including Kuwait, Dubai, Abu Dhabi, Riyadh, Jeddah, Doha, Sharjah and Manama.
